Factors influencing the use of retail cross-docks

Cross-docking depends on continuous communication between suppliers,


distribution centers, and all points of sale
Customer and supplier geography, particularly when a single corporate customer
has many multiple branches or using points
Freight costs for the commodities being transported
Cost of inventory in transit
Complexity of loads
Handling methods
Logistics software integration between supplier(s), vendor, and shipper
Tracking of inventory in transit.

Hygienic aspects of managing Pallets in the Food Industry

The pallets must be stored instead preferably covered. These should be


stored in an organized manner. In many plants we have seen pallets
disorganized in the outer areas, these become shelter for pests. When we
store the pallets outside these may be contaminated with fecal matter from
birds, rats, insects all potential of contamination of microorganisms.

If stored outside when entering the plant must be cleaned and inspected to
ensure that they do not carry roaches or rats to stay hidden among them.
Normally we do not take a single palette, but these are transported using
forklifts on each other and this is conducive to that rats can hide.

Keep separate pallets. Pallets for hygienic areas should not be used in any
other zone and must be properly identified.

The quality of wooden pallets is also important. Quality control should


ensure good cutting boards and avoid having chips. There should be no
protruding nails.
The moisture content of the wood has a great influence on the survival and
growth of microbes. A general rule is that the timber will have moisture
content below 20% to prevent the growth of fungi and bacteria. A higher
moisture content the better survival of the bacteria. Therefore, they must be
stored under controlled conditions.

As for meat products and seafood wooden pallets can only be used for
transport of packaged products.

Some food products are also very sensitive to deterioration in the taste for
odors. Some people have discussed the possibility of using stainless steel
pallets for transporting food.

To avoid possible contamination, cheap and easy solution is to use wooden


pallets with slip sheet on top. The blades can be held in separate areas and
the sliding plates can be made of various reusable materials.
